About this study

In a placebo-controlled double-blind between-subject design experiment, investigators plan to investigate the effect of oxytocin treatment on attentional processing of emotional faces. Subjects complete questionnaires in Chinese versions before treatment administration, including the Beck Depression Inventory, Autism Spectrum Quotient , Trait Anxiety Inventory, Toronto Alexithymia Scale, Multidimentional Assessment of Interoceptive Awareness. This experiment consists of two tasks including Emotional Face Cue-target Task and Visual Search Task. In the first task, subjects need to make a response to judge the position of target after a cue-target is presented. In the second task, subjects are asked to search the target "U" or inverted "U" placed on the nose of emotional/neutral faces and make an choices based on their oorientation. During these phases, subjects' response accuracy, response time and electrophysiological activity (ERP) are recorded.

Primary outcomes

  1. Response time in reponse to different emotional face targets.

    Time frame: 1 hour

    Response time in discriminating which side (left or right) the emotional face target appear.

  2. N2pc

    Time frame: 1 hour

    N2pc is an enhanced negative event-related potential typically elicited at posterior electrodes (e.g., PO7 and PO8) contralateral to the target presented among distractors between 180 and 300 ms after the onset of stimuli.

    display.

Secondary outcomes

  1. Response accuracy in response to different emotional face targets.

    Time frame: 1 hour

    Response accuracy is caculated by the precentage of correct responses among the total responses in discriminating the position (left or right side) of different face conditions.
